      I have a small project that I am working on. The project will be part of a bands stage show, and will be required to playback a base .WAV for each track.
      I don't have a mac, so I want to know what my audio playback options moving a file from a windows machine to a mac PLAY ONLY setup.
      Now I imagine that I can only run the non-core version since I am developing on windows.
      What will be my most professional audio setup I can manage with this? Do I just setup quicktime to use thier external audio interface?

      I have little mac experience with OSX, so I appreciate any help you mac guru's can share.

              I have done it a few times. 

              it will be the media that will likely cause you the most problems. Just make sure all your media is converted to .mov MJPEG at 70+% and you should be ok.
